A vulnerability, which was classified as problematic, was found in ArcadeData ArcadeDB up to 26.9.0. Affected is an unknown code block of the component Out Edges In Edges Buckets.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a improper authorization vulnerability. CWE is classifying the issue as CWE-285. The product does not perform or incorrectly performs an authorization check when an actor attempts to access a resource or perform an action. This is going to have an impact on integrity. CVE summarizes:

ArcadeDB before 26.9.1 (com.arcadedb:arcadedb-engine <= 26.8.1) fails to bind the authenticated principal onto the DatabaseAsyncTransaction async worker threads used by the parallel edge-connect phase of POST /api/v1/batch/{database}. Because those workers have no current user, LocalDatabase.checkPermissionsOnFile returns early and allows the write, bypassing per-type CREATE_RECORD/UPDATE_RECORD ACL enforcement. In deployments that rely on per-type or per-group ACLs, an authenticated low-privilege user holding CREATE_RECORD on an edge type E but with CREATE_RECORD/UPDATE_RECORD revoked on a vertex type V can submit a graph edge-load batch request (with parallelFlush at its default value of true) and durably append edges to protected vertices of type V by writing records into V's <V>_out_edges/<V>_in_edges buckets, resulting in unauthorized modification of graph adjacency. Setting parallelFlush=false causes the request to be correctly rejected. This is an incomplete fix of GHSA-c23x-pqcj-7hfm, which bound the principal only on the HTTP handler thread.

The advisory is shared for download at github.com. This vulnerability is traded as CVE-2026-93596 since 09/18/2026. The exploitability is told to be easy. It is possible to launch the attack remotely. There are neither technical details nor an exploit publicly available. The MITRE ATT&CK project declares the attack technique as T1548.002.

Upgrading to version 26.9.1 eliminates this vulnerability.
